TV Chariot

Entry updated 4 April 2017. Tagged: Publication.

Letter-size saddle-stapled Television Fanzine printed on middle-grade paper. Published by T C Chariot Productions. Editor: Robert Cain. Assistant Editor: Maureen Cain. Twelve (?) issues, 1977 to 1979. Publication schedule was bimonthly.

Well-produced fanzine dedicated primarily to US sf Television programmes with some occasional film coverage. While most of the content focused on then-recent productions including Buck Rogers in the 25th Century (1979-1981) and Mork & Mindy (1978-1981), other articles looked at such programmes of the past as The Twilight Zone (1959-1964). Illustrations were all black and white. Occasionally, Comics pages from artist-author Fred Hembeck were laid in, along with special offers for various masks and plastic model kits spun off from assorted television series. TV Chariot was published from Arizona and distribution seems to have been largely confined to the western USA. [GSt].
